What Is Covered Under 4D Bioprinting Market?

4D bioprinting is an advanced manufacturing technology that integrates 3D bioprinting with dynamic functionalities, enabling the fabrication of biomimetic structures capable of changing shape or function over time in response to external stimuli. 4D bioprinting allows for the creation of tissues and structures that can mimic the dynamic functionalities of natural tissues The main technologies of 4D bioprinting are extrusion-based technology, laser-based technology, inkjet-based technology, and others. Extrusion-based technology refers to a type of additive manufacturing process where material is selectively dispensed through a nozzle or orifice to create a three-dimensional object. They are used for various application include biomedical application, and others by pharmaceutical and biotechnology companies, academic research and development, and others.

What Is The Driver Of The 4D Bioprinting Market?

The increasing demand for organ transplants is expected to propel the growth of the 4D bioprinting market going forward. Organ transplants involve surgically removing an organ or tissue from one person (the donor) and placing it in another person (the recipient) who needs that organ due to organ failure or dysfunction. The demand for organ transplants arises from the critical need to save lives and improve the quality of life for individuals suffering from organ failure or dysfunction. Organ transplants use 4D bioprinting to advance regenerative medicine by precisely fabricating complex tissues and organs with functional capabilities, offering hope for addressing the shortage of donor organs and improving transplant outcomes. For instance, in January 2025, according to the Organ Procurement and Transplantation Network (OPTN), a US-based government organization, in 2024, the number of organ transplants surpassed 48,000, marking a 3.3% increase compared to 2023. Therefore, the increasing demand for organ transplants is driving the growth of the 4D bioprinting industry.

What Are Latest Mergers And Acquisitions In The 4D Bioprinting Market?

In March 2024, Poietis, a France-based biotechnology company that provides 4D laser bioprinting, partnered with HVD Life Science company to advance the development of bioprinted tissue models for regenerative medicine and drug testing. With this partnership, Poietis aims to promote the Next Generation Bioprinting (NGB-R) platform in Germany and enhance access to advanced bioprinting technology for researchers in the fields of tissue engineering, regenerative medicine, and drug discovery. HVD Life Science is an Austria-based marketing and distribution company specialized in life science solutions.
